World number five Svetlana Kuznetsova from Russia blitzed world number one Amelie Mauresmo from France in straight sets at the China Open final on Sunday.
2004 China Open runner-up Kuznetsova finally crowned at the tournament after beating the Frenchwoman 6-4, 6-0 in just one hour and two minutes.
"It is a pity to lose the game, and I am a little bit disappointed. I did not win a single game in the second set, Kuznetsova played very well."said Mauresmo.
Mauresmo broke in the third game of the match to set up a 3-1lead. The Russian turned favor in the eighth game by breaking and then the match was rained off and suspended for about one hour and a half or so.
The remaining match only last no more than 20 minutes since it was resumed, with Kuznetsova adjusting herself more quickly and the Frenchwoman committing too many unforced errors to lose the first set 6-4 through another break and the second set at love.
"Kuznetsova is a top five player. She has a great season, and came back so strongly this year." said Mauresmo."The rain did have some effect, but it happens quite often in the season, you have to adjust yourself. Kuznetsova played really better than me."
"As the top player, you can not win all the time, there are something upset, that's what it is. And I was really tired after Saturday's match against Jankovic."
The Frenchwoman on Saturday gave it all to survive a threatening sixth seed Jankovic in a two-hour, 41-minute marathon semifinal while Kuznetsova needed only 50 minutes to thrash China's Peng Shuai.
While Kuznetsova, playing her second straight final and winning Bali crown last week in Indonesia, have improved the record against Mauresmo to 3-4 and secured the second straight WTA title.
"Mauresmo played badly, and made too many mistakes. Luckily I broke her before the rain, and I still maintain the confidence when the game started again."
"Both of us are nernous after the break. I did well enough but she was out of shape tonight, I scored through many easy balls."
